WebSpecific short-term effects of some hallucinogens include: increased blood pressure, breathing rate, or body temperature loss of appetite dry mouth sleep problems spiritual … WebPsilocybin is converted by the body to psilocin, and this is the actual compound which produces their psychoactive effects. Additional chemicals commonly present in minor amounts include baeocystin and norbaeocystin, although the extent to which these contribute to the overall effects is unclear.
